What Exactly is E-Commerce Affiliate Marketing?

Okay, let’s break it down. E-commerce affiliate marketing is all about partnering with online stores to promote their products. They give you a special link (your affiliate link) that you can share with your friends, followers, or anyone who might be interested in their stuff. When someone clicks your link and buys something, you earn a percentage of that sale. That’s your commission! Think of it as a referral fee, but online.

For example, let’s say you love a particular brand of shoes sold on Lazada. You can join their affiliate program, get your unique affiliate link for those shoes, and then share it on your Facebook page, a blog post, or even just send it to a friend who you know loves shoes. If that friend clicks your link and buys the shoes, you get a cut of the sale. The amount of the cut, or commission, is determined by Lazada in their affiliate program. It could be 5%, 10%, or even more! It all depends on the product and the affiliate program.

Why is E-Commerce Affiliate Marketing a Good Option in the Philippines?

The Philippines is a fantastic place to get into e-commerce affiliate marketing for several reasons. First, internet access is becoming more widespread. More and more Filipinos are getting online, especially through their mobile phones. This means a bigger audience for your affiliate links. In fact, a report by Statista shows a continuous rise in internet penetration and usage every year. The Philippines also has a young and digitally savvy population who are always on the lookout for the best deals and newest products online. This is where you, as an affiliate marketer, come in!

Secondly, e-commerce is booming in the Philippines. Platforms like Lazada, Shopee, and Zalora are hugely popular, and they all have affiliate programs. This gives you plenty of options to choose from. You can promote anything from fashion and electronics to home goods and even groceries. The growing popularity of online shopping in the Philippines means more opportunities for you to earn commissions.

Finally, it’s relatively easy to get started. You don’t need a lot of upfront investment or technical skills. All you need is a computer or smartphone, an internet connection, and a willingness to learn. You can start with a free blog, a social media account, or even just by sharing links with your friends and family.

2. Find Affiliate Programs

Once you’ve chosen your niche, it’s time to find affiliate programs to join. Most major e-commerce platforms in the Philippines offer affiliate programs. Look for programs that align with your niche and offer competitive commission rates.

Some popular affiliate programs in the Philippines include:

  • Lazada Affiliate Program: One of the biggest e-commerce platforms in the Philippines, offering a wide range of products.
  • Shopee Affiliate Program: Another major e-commerce platform with a large selection of products and attractive commission rates.
  • Zalora Affiliate Program: Focuses on fashion and beauty products, ideal if your niche is in that area.
  • BeautyMNL Affiliate Program: As the name would suggest, they specialise in beauty products.

When choosing an affiliate program, consider the following:

  • Commission rate: How much will you earn per sale?
  • Product selection: Does the program offer products that align with your niche?
  • Payment terms: How often will you get paid, and what are the payment methods?

Understanding Commission Structures

Understanding commission structures is important to maximize earnings. Common structures include:

  • Pay-per-sale: You earn a commission for every sale made through your affiliate link.
  • Pay-per-lead: You earn a commission for every lead generated through your affiliate link (e.g., someone signing up for a newsletter).
  • Pay-per-click: You earn a small commission for every click on your affiliate link.

The most common type is pay-per-sale. For example, if you are part of the Lazada affiliate program, you earn a commission based on a percentage of the sale. If the item costs PHP 1,000 and the commission is 5%, you earn PHP 50. Some programs also offer tiered commission structures. The more sales you generate, the higher your commission rate becomes.

FAQ Section

What if I do not have a website or am not tech savvy?
You don’t necessarily need a website to get started. You can promote affiliate links through social media, email marketing, or even by sharing them directly with friends and family. While a website can give you more control and credibility, it’s not a requirement. There are also plenty of user-friendly website builders like Wix and Weebly that make it easy to create a simple website without any coding skills. There are many blogs and Youtube tutorials with step-by-step instructions.

Does affiliate marketing work in the Philippines?
Yes! With Filipinos being avid online shoppers and high internet penetration, there’s a large potential audience. The key is to find and promote products that resonate with your target audience. Start by targeting specific niches, such as beauty, fashion, or tech.

How much money can I really earn in affiliate marketing?
Earnings vary depending on the niche, traffic, effort, and the quality of content. Some people make a few hundred pesos a month, while others earn thousands of dollars. Consistency and dedication are key. Treat it like a business; the more effort you put in, the better the return.

How do I avoid scams when choosing an affiliate program?
Look for well-established programs with good reputations, read reviews, and check the terms and conditions. Avoid any program that asks for a large upfront fee or promises unrealistic earning potential. Look for well-known programs on reputable platforms within the local e-commerce industry. If a program seems too good to be true, it likely is.
